Transaction 80759505101e8480c89f7281b6bca4b70d9667c22357659ed7cc84a0bba4aabd
1 Input
1 Output
-
80759505101e8480c89f7281b6bca4b70d9667c22357659ed7cc84a0bba4aabd:0
- value
- 120400
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 9a31e366ae8cd56892874713ee7d087d24ddb29c529227ad4a3c05f7643ab3dc
- address
- bc1pngc7xe4w3n2k3y58guf7ulgg05jdmv5u22fz0t228szlwep6k0wq2h8hgf